About

Love Creek County Park is a Michigan county park with maintained cross-country trails. The park setting supports local winter skiing, nature programs, and community outdoor recreation.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the vertical drop at Love Creek County Park?

Love Creek County Park has a vertical drop of 101 feet (31 meters).

What is the peak elevation of Love Creek County Park?

The summit of Love Creek County Park sits at 772 feet (235 meters) above sea level.

Does Love Creek County Park offer night skiing?

Yes, Love Creek County Park offers night skiing. Hours and trail availability vary by season, so check the official website for current schedules.

Does Love Creek County Park have snowmaking?

No, Love Creek County Park relies on natural snowfall and does not operate snowmaking equipment.

How much snow does Love Creek County Park get each year?

Love Creek County Park averages around 65 inches (165 cm) of snowfall per season.

Does Love Creek County Park have a ski school?

Yes, Love Creek County Park operates a ski and snowboard school offering lessons for a range of ability levels.
